Daughter Of Baylor Coach Art Briles Was Inside Cowboys Facility When Roof Collapsed

WACO (May 2, 2009)--News 10 has learned that Baylor Head Football Coach Art Briles' daughter Jancy was inside of the Dallas Cowboys practice facility when 60 to 70 MPH winds ripped through the building. Jancy Briles works in the Public Relations department for the team.

News 10 confirmed that Jancy sustained "a bump on the head" when the roof was blown off the facility. According to Baylor officials, she was "checked out and released" and is doing fine.

Coach Briles was seen leaving the Texas High School Football Hall of Fame Induction banquet in Waco shortly after the ceremony started.
